Python生成Excel文件:一步步指南248
在当今数据驱动的世界中,能够生成和处理Excel文件对于数据分析、报告和管理至关重要。Python作为一门功能强大的编程语言,提供了多种工具和库,使您可以轻松地生成和操作Excel文件。
使用Openpyxl库
Openpyxl是Python中用于处理Excel文件最流行的库之一。它提供了一个直观且功能强大的API,允许您创建、读取和修改Excel文件。
要使用Openpyxl,请先使用以下命令安装它:```
pip install openpyxl
```
然后,您可以导入Openpyxl并开始使用它:```python
import openpyxl
# 创建一个新的工作簿
wb = ()
# 激活第一个工作表
ws = 
# 在A1单元格写入数据
ws["A1"] = "你好,世界!"
# 保存工作簿
("")
```
这将创建一个名为""的新Excel文件,其中包含在A1单元格中写入的文本"你好,世界!"。
其他库
除了Openpyxl,还有其他一些可以用于生成Excel文件的Python库,包括:* XlsxWriter:一个快速而内存高效的库,适合处理大型文件。
* XLWings:一个允许您直接从Python控制Microsoft Excel的库。
* Pandas:一个用于数据操作和分析的库,它可以将数据写入Excel文件。
高级功能
使用Python生成Excel文件时,您可以访问一系列高级功能,例如:* 样式和格式:您可以为单元格设置字体、颜色、对齐和边框等样式。
* 图表和图形:您可以创建柱状图、折线图、饼形图和其他类型的图表和图形。
* 公式和函数:您可以使用Python中的公式和函数来执行计算并在Excel工作表中使用它们。
* 保护和加密:您可以保护工作表和工作簿,限制对数据和内容的访问。
通过使用Python和Openpyxl等库,您可以轻松快速地生成和操作Excel文件。从创建基本工作表到使用高级功能,Python提供了广泛的可能性,使您可以有效地处理数据并生成有用的报告。
2024-10-13
PHP连接Oracle并安全高效获取数据库版本信息的完整指南
https://www.shuihudhg.cn/132186.html
Python模块化开发:构建高质量可维护的代码库实战指南
https://www.shuihudhg.cn/132185.html
PHP深度解析:如何获取和处理外部URL的Cookie信息
https://www.shuihudhg.cn/132184.html
PHP数据库连接故障:从根源解决常见难题
https://www.shuihudhg.cn/132183.html
Python数字代码雨:从终端到GUI的沉浸式视觉盛宴
https://www.shuihudhg.cn/132182.html
热门文章
Python 格式化字符串
https://www.shuihudhg.cn/1272.html
Python 函数库:强大的工具箱,提升编程效率
https://www.shuihudhg.cn/3366.html
Python向CSV文件写入数据
https://www.shuihudhg.cn/372.html
Python 静态代码分析:提升代码质量的利器
https://www.shuihudhg.cn/4753.html
Python 文件名命名规范:最佳实践
https://www.shuihudhg.cn/5836.html